WRC Golden Estrus Gel
MSRP: $12.99/1-ounce bottle

Member Tested Rating: 8.0


Golden Estrus Gel from Wildlife Research Center is a strong, sticky, long-lasting sexual attractant for whitetail bucks. Smear the thick-like-honey scent on a wick, branch or twig for ultimate attraction power before and during the rut. Contact Wildlife Research Center at: (800) 873-5873; wildlife.com.

Golden Estrus Gel
Guys ! You have missed the full scope of things; most attractants will work. You have to have proper placement, wind direction, human scent control, travel areas, and most of all you have to stick with the same scent you are useing. If you start trying and mixing scents in the same season all you are going to do is chase the deer AWAY . They are a creature of habit. You change things up, you LOOSE your pattern you have tried to establish. Stick with what works best for your area and habitat. If you want to try something new; wait for the next year and use it all season and then compare your notes. You DO NOT want to strike out when that buck of a lifetime comes by and you spook him out of your shooting lane with scent confusion. Remember ! You are entering their world out in the wild ; its not a drive around the block or eveybody would be doing it with great success !!!! Great Hunting Wayne Bernhardt Life Member Nicholasville, KY
